How to Easily Make a Schedule
- 1). Write your recurring obligations at their scheduled times in the planner. Include events like school, work, club meetings, chores and pickups.
- 2). Write in your one-time and temporary obligations at their scheduled times. Include events like jury duty, weddings, funerals, art performances and meetings.
- 3). Write in your travel time from one event to the next. For example, it may take you 15 minutes to drive from home to your children's school to pick them up at 2:30 p.m. In that case you would schedule "Drive to school" at 2:15 p.m.
- 4). Write in events you would like to attend at their scheduled times. Include vacations, art performances, parties and sales. Write in such events only where nothing else is already scheduled, since your obligations are most important.
